There are two types of parallel programers I tried during my work with 51s:

1) programer do not start programing if wrong device is selected. First of all, it reads the signature of a chip inserted; if it is not correct for device selected, then programming does not start.

2) programmer does not read signature. It starts to programing with algorithm of selected device. Usually it fails at check point after the first block of data has been wrote due different devices has different algorithm/setup pins and signals.

I have checked my database and found that S52 has different pins` programming setup from both C52 and S8252. So it seems original poster has selected correct device due programing.
